    I hope it is ok to group these five locos on one thread, but I am keen to know the current situation of them all.

    Firstly 31806, that did so very well at the Spa Valley Railway Gala and following weekend, and I guess it is on its way back, or already back at Swanage after its use at the Mid Norfolk Gala last weekend.

    I believe it had a boiler swap with 31874 to keep it in service, so does anyone know how much longer 31806 is expected to be operational under its current ticket etc please - usual caveats apply of course!

    It will be great to see it out visiting near Kent again, but I do appreciate the very high cost of moving a tender loco around. Of course for me it is truly wonderful to see it as BR Southern Region 31806!

    Then any updates on 31618, 31625, 31638 and 31874 if possible please. I have been to what I think are the relevant websites, but I wonder if there is any more recent news.

    31618 and 1638 are both in storage at Sheffield Park waiting for their overhauls.

    31618 is planned to begin once the overhauls of Q 30541 and Schools 928 Stowe is complete

    31806 has an active ticket (subject to usual caveats and annual inspections) till late 2030/early 2031

    31625 is/was tucked into a safe siding at Furzebrook on the Swanage Railway beyond Norden and just about visible if travelling onto River Frome and Wareham.
    I remember seeing it when first arrived at Mid Hants around 1980 and travelled down to see a first steaming - around 96??
